REESON Education is seeking a compassionate Autism Specialist Teacher for a supportive school in Doncaster, starting September 2026. This role requires a dedicated professional who is passionate about helping pupils with Autism Spectrum Condition (ASC) achieve their full potential.
The Autism Specialist Teacher will deliver tailored lessons in a structured environment, using effective strategies to enhance learning, communication, and emotional wellbeing. A commitment to safeguarding and a relevant enhanced DBS check are required for this role.
